Gyeonggi Province has mediated 444 franchise business disputes over the past five years, achieving a mediation success rate of 88%.


On the 13th, Gyeonggi Province announced that the Gyeonggi Province Franchise Business Transaction Dispute Mediation Committee, now in its sixth year since establishment, has handled a total of 444 dispute mediations over the past five years and achieved an 88% mediation success rate.


The provincial Franchise Business Transaction Dispute Mediation Committee was launched following the 2019 amendment to the Act on the Fairness of Franchise Business Transactions, which allowed local governments to mediate disputes arising between franchisors and franchisees.


Over the past five years, the Dispute Mediation Committee received 467 mediation requests and processed 444 cases. Excluding dismissed or withdrawn cases, 292 cases were handled, of which 257 were successfully mediated, resulting in an approximately 88% mediation success rate.


The number of dispute mediations handled annually shows an increasing trend: 74 cases in 2019, 84 in 2020, 83 in 2021, 108 in 2022, and 118 in 2023.


Gyeonggi Province noted that joint dispute mediation cases are particularly complex due to the conflicting interests of the parties involved, making mediation outcomes challenging; however, agreements were reached in 3 out of 8 such cases. Due to these achievements, Gyeonggi Province received a plaque of appreciation from the National Franchisee Association in December last year.


Reviewing the 444 disputes handled by Gyeonggi Province over the past five years, the most common issue was the burden of unfair compensation obligations, accounting for 105 cases (24%). This was followed by false or exaggerated information provision with 62 cases (14%), non-refund of franchise fees with 44 cases (10%), and violations of obligations such as providing disclosure documents with 43 cases (10%).



Lee Moon-gyo, Director of the Fair Economy Division of Gyeonggi Province, stated, "This year marks the sixth year since the launch of the Gyeonggi Province Franchise Business Transaction Dispute Mediation Committee. Based on the experience accumulated through mediating numerous disputes over the past five years, we will do our utmost to find the best possible agreements between disputing parties and achieve smooth and prompt mediation success this year as well."
